Excellence Exchange: The Future of Lancaster’s Workforce

Lancaster’s long-term competitiveness depends on the strength of its workforce - our ability to attract, retain, and grow the people who fuel our businesses. Join fellow executives to examine Lancaster’s workforce landscape and engage in a candid conversation on how we can collectively build a sustainable pipeline of talent to secure our region’s future.

PLUS: we’ll showcase and explore how Land in Lancaster is positioning our region as a destination of choice for talent and how your business can leverage it to strengthen recruitment, retention, and long-term growth.

Why attend?

  • Understand the landscape of talent attraction: why it matters for your business and how Lancaster competes nationally.
  • Explore Land in Lancaster as a shared language for telling our region’s story—and a tool to strengthen your recruitment and retention efforts.
  • Connect with fellow executives to identify shared solutions to a shared challenge.

Meet the Speakers!

Christian Recknagel: Chief Culture Officer at TAIT Towers Manufacturing

Christian spent the first 20 years of his career as a consultant supporting leadership at all levels of organizations by driving high performance cultures through individual coaching and team dynamics. Since joining the TAIT team in July 2019 Christian has worked to build a culture of learning through championing leadership principles, guiding initiatives that drive high performance throughout the business, and embedding core purpose and beliefs throughout the organization. He is responsible for company culture, inclusion, and sustainability functions with the support of global and local leaders on each team. He lives in Lancaster, PA with his wife Danene and his daughter Lia and loves cycling in the rolling hills of southcentral PA.

Laurie Grove: Director of Career Services at Thaddeus Stevens College of Technology

For over 20 years, I have been leading the Career Services department at Thaddeus Stevens College of Technology. We help students figure out what they’re great at and connect them with high-paying, in-demand careers. At the same time, we work with employers to find team members who aren’t just skilled, but incredibly coachable and ready to grow. It’s all about building real relationships—between students, schools, and businesses—to make those win-win connections happen. Collaborating with faculty and employers, we prepare students for in-field work experiences and graduates for meaningful, full-time employment. 

Before joining the college, I worked for Marriott International for nearly 15 years, first as a Director of Sales for extended stay hotels, and then as a National Sales Training Consultant, traveling across the US to provide sales and presentation coaching to new sales managers. I hold a BS in Communications Media from Indiana University of Pennsylvania, and I have certifications in MBTI and Communispond Facilitation Training. A connector, I am passionate about networking, mentoring, training, and volunteering with organizations and committees that support the development and diversity of students and professionals in the Central Pennsylvania region.


Heather Valudes, CCE: President & CEO of The Lancaster Chamber

Heather Valudes is President & CEO of the Lancaster Chamber, leading efforts to support 1,300+ business members and the broader Lancaster County community. Since joining the Chamber in 2011, she has advanced key legislative initiatives, represented business interests, and helped earn four-star accreditation from the U.S. Chamber of Commerce.

Heather holds both a bachelor’s degree in Political Science and a Master of Public Administration from West Chester University, and in 2021 earned the Certified Chamber Executive designation. She has been recognized as a “40 Under 40” honoree by the Central Penn Business Journal and the Association of Chamber of Commerce Executives.

A lifelong Lancaster County resident, she lives in West Lampeter with her husband, Kevin, and their twin daughters, and serves on the board for CHI St. Joseph’s Health, Prima Theatre, and the Paradise Township Lions Club


What is the Excellence Exchange?

Excellence Exchange cultivates a space for you to hear innovative, noteworthy business practices and participate in small group discussions with other leaders in the community. You will gain insight into the successes and challenges facing organizations across a range of industries and discuss practical strategies for applying the lessons learned within your own workplace.
